Abstract | ||
A series of ethyl 2-substituted aminopyrido [3',2': 5,6] thiopyrano [ 4,3,2-de] quinoline-1-carboxylate (VII)i-viii was obtained by reacting ethyl2-chloropyrido[3',2':5,6] thiopyrano [4,3,2-de] quinoline-1-carboxylate (VIa) with certain aromatic amines. Another series of ethyl 6-chloro-9,11-dimethyl-2-substituted aminopyrdo [3',2':5,6] thiopyrano [ 4,3,2-de] quinoline-1-carboxylate (VIIb)i-viii was also obtained by reacting ethyl 2,6-dichloro-9,11-dimethylpyrido [3',2':5,6] thiopyrano[4,3,2-de] quinoline-1-carboxylate )VIb) with different amines. Molecular modeling study and in vitro cytotoxic effect of some samples of the synthesized compounds were also achieved. | ||
